Have been frustrated last two years with back view camera becomming usless with water covering it while driving in rain, and after driving all day in driving rain from Ft Smith AK to Lawton OK with no distortion of the picture at all suddenly realized that I had corrected the situation without realizing it. I had recently installed solar panels on the roof at the rear of the coach so the cable runs to the battery would be shorter, down through the rear cap. Apparently the panel at the rear of the coach breaks up the air flow sufficiently so that rain is no longer sucked up and onto the camera lens.
